Name of the Project
Sanbrado underground gold project.

Location
Burkina Faso.

Project Owner/s
West African Resources.

Project Description
A scoping study has proposed the development of an underground development beneath the M5 South openpit at the Sanbrado gold mine.

The study envisages average underground production of 35 000 oz/y of gold over a five-year life-of-mine (LoM). The addition of the M5 South underground to the production plan at Sanbrado is expected to displace close to two-million tonnes of lower-grade openpit material over the LoM, resulting in an increase in production by up to 25 000 oz/y over the current ten-year plan from 2026. Consequently, Sanbrado will maintain production above 200 000 oz of gold.

M5 South underground is expected to deliver 1.8-million tonnes at 3.1 g/t for 188000 oz of gold over a five-year LoM. It has been designed to use mining equipment in use at M1 South to maximise operational synergies between the two mines. West African Resources’ unhedged ten-year production outlook estimates production of more than 200 000 oz/y of gold in 2023 and 2024, and more than 400 000 oz/y from 2025 to 2032.

Capital Expenditure
Preproduction capital expenditure is estimated at $20-millon.

Planned Start/End Date
West African Resources is working on the proposed underground development of M5 South, which includes further drilling, geotechnical studies and mine planning. Subject to a positive outcome being achieved from the studies, West African Resources aims to start portal establishment and underground development in the second half of 2025, leading to full underground production by mid-2026.
